Description

Position: Maintenance Assistant

The Purpose of this position is to plan, organize, develop and assist the Maintenance Supervisor with the overall operation of the Maintenance Department in accordance with the current local, state, and federal standers, guidelines and regulations, and as directed by the Administrator to assure that the facility is maintained in a safe and comfortable manor.

Qualifications

  • Communication Skills and active Listening
  • Must be willing to work flexible hours
  • Must have painting and drywall experience
  • Must have electric and plumbing experience
  • Moderate to heavy physical effort including lifting up to 65 pounds is required
  • Frequent walking or standing required

Position Summary/Duties:

  • Assist with competing regulars rounds of the facility to check all maintenance zones to ensure the quality control and safety, health and welfare of patients, employees, families, visitors in the facility, and correct or report equipment failure or damage to the Administrator immediately.
  • Assist with Checking air conditioning and heating units on roof and in patients' rooms, office, and other rooms in the facility
  • Assist with checking pump station and breaker panels, washers, and dryers in laundry
  • Assist with making daily repairs as needed
  • Assist with Checking water and boiler temperatures, dietary cooking equipment, cooling equipment, public address systems, fire extinguishers and alarms, fire doors, and electrical outlets.
  • Assist with the inspection of storage rooms, work rooms, utility and janitorial closets for up-keep, supply, control and safety.
  • Coordinates work of maintenance department with other department functions so as not to interrupt patient care or normal business functions.
  • Able to be on call for emergencies.
  • Runs errands, handles incoming and outgoing freight, lifts and moves heavy furniture and equipment, and other miscellaneous duties as directed by the administrator.
  • Responsible for the care, maintenance and repairs of institutional property, equipment and grounds as directed by the administrator.
  • Regular inspection of property and equipment for compliance with safety regulations.
  • Perform other duties as assigned from time to time.
